Pilot Study of the Safety of a Daily Ethanol Lock for Urinary Catheters in Critically Ill Children
Description

Hypothesis 1: Blood alcohol concentration will be \<25 mg/100ml (equivalent to a blood alcohol concentration of \<0.025%) after a 1 hour urinary catheter ethanol lock. Hypothesis 2: Daily urinary catheter ethanol locks will not result in increased hematuria or increased urinary white cells.

Urinary Catheter Self-Discontinuation After Urogynecology Surgery
Description

The goal of this randomized clinical trial is to determine if removal of transurethral urinary catheters by patients at home is as safe as catheter removal in the office following urogynecologic surgery. Participants will be randomized to either standard catheter removal in the office or catheter self-removal at home.

Bladder Catheters During Ablation Procedures
Description

Inserting a Bladder catheter during catheter ablation is standard practice at most Institutions. Unfortunately, bladder catheters are associated with adverse outcomes, including catheter associated cystitis, hematuria, dysuria, and urethral damage. The investigator proposes a prospective, randomized clinical trial comparing group A that will receive a catheter during the ablation procedure and group B that will not receive the procedure. The Investigator hypothesizes the group receiving the bladder catheters will have a higher rate of complications.

Prevention of Post-operative Urinary Retention
Description

The purpose of this study is to determine if tamsulosin ("FLOMAX") is effective in preventing post-operative urinary retention following abdominal surgery. Post-operative urinary retention is a common post-operative complication, occurring in up to 30% of patients undergoing abdominal surgery. It can be described as the inability to initiate urination or properly empty one's bladder following surgery. It is usually self-limited, but it requires the use of catheterization to empty the bladder in order to prevent further injury to the bladder or kidneys and to relief the discomfort of a full bladder. Tamsulosin is a medication that is commonly used in men with urinary symptoms related to an enlarged prostate. There is some evidence to suggest that it may also potentially be beneficial for preventing post-operative urinary retention. Therefore, in this research study, subjects scheduled for abdominal surgery will be randomly assigned to take either tamsulosin once-daily or placebo once-daily for one week leading up to surgery, and up to several days after surgery. Urinary function will be assessed and compared between these two treatments. The hypothesis is that tamsulosin will reduce the rate of postoperative urinary retention compared to placebo.

Evaluation of the Novel Silq ClearTract Catheter in Patients With Chronic Urinary Retention
Description

To assess the ability of the Silq ClearTract™ 100% Silicone 2-Way Foley Catheter to reduce catheter associated complications in subjects that require a long-term indwelling Foley catheter when compared to other commercially available Foley catheters.
